About the Company

Innomotics is an industry-leading supplier of motors and large drive systems with a trusted legacy of more than 150 years of engineering expertise, powering essential industries worldwide and advancing the Energy Transition with high‑efficiency designs.

About the Role

The CAD Automaton Engineer will be part of the Product Engineering group for Large High Voltage Motors. The engineer will develop mechanical software tools used by the Mechanical Design team, generating 3-D motor models and customer software with user or automated input. Position is held in Norwood, Ohio with a hybrid office/remote schedule. Travel is rare but may be required in special circumstances.

Responsibilities
  • Develop drafting and modeling software with globally shared tools such as Rulestream.
  • Read and interpret 2-D/3-D CAD drawings created by Innomotics or provided by customers.
  • Identify process improvements and offer valid solutions through an IT lens.
  • Own completed software tools to drive future maintenance and enhancements.
  • Communicate effectively with the Norwood Product Engineering team.
  • Communicate effectively with the IN HV Global IT team.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ering or IT required.
  • 2-5 years of experience in both 3-D modeling and programming.
  • Project management experience.
  • Proficiency in 2-D/3-D modeling and NX.
  • Fundamental experience with typical programming languages.
  • Experience in mechanical or electrical drafting.
  • Mechanical engineering solutions‑based mindset.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and collaborate with local and overseas teams.
  • Understanding of electronic motor configurations.
  • Excellent computer skills:
    Microsoft Word, PowerPoint, Excel, and Outlook.
